WebMar 11, 2024 · Relationship Between CST Transmission and VAC. Spinal cord injury diminishes the capacity of the CST to transmit descending neural signals, thereby limiting both strength and speed of VAC in the dorsiflexors. WebCraniosacral therapy (CST) is a gentle hands-on treatment that may provide relief from a variety of symptoms including headaches, neck pain and side effects of cancer … WebYour spinal cord is the long, cylindrical structure that connects your brain and lower back. It contains tissues, fluids and nerve cells. A bony column of vertebrae surrounds and protects your spinal cord. Your spinal cord helps carry electrical nerve signals throughout your body. These nerve signals help you feel sensations and move your muscles.
